This is an 8" x 8" page that I plan on framing, along with three others -- one for each season . . . so be on the look out for upcoming ones! I started out with some orange diamond paper by Scrappin' Sports and added a distressed piece of patterned paper by We R Memory Keepers (retired, made exclusively for Recollections) -- a favorite I had in my stash.
The photo is framed with Prism Papaya Puree Dark cardstock and accented with some ribbon pieces that were faux stitched on. The 'Autumn' lettering was cut from some more Scrappin' Sports green plaid paper with Spellbinders' Excalibur Alphabet. The letters were adhered to the page and then shadowed/outlined with E27 Copic marker.
I created the pumpkin by cutting more Prism Papaya cardstock with Spellbinders Nestabilities Classic Ovals (large set), crumpling the cardstock and then inking/distressing it with Clearsnap's ColorBox Chestnut Roan fluid chalk ink.
Three ovals were layered together with dimensional foam tape and topped with one of the doodle dies from Spellbinders Doodle Parts set! I added 'Harvest Time' to the pumpkin by using JustRite's Small Letter Set and smaller C-30 Monogram Stamper. The curve of that size circle stamper fit very well on these oval shapes.
